Synopsis As Introduced
Amends the Municipal Code. In a Section pertaining to jurisdictional boundary line agreements between municipalities, provides that no jurisdictional boundary line agreement shall be valid for a term exceeding 5 years (now, 20 years), and that, if no term is stated, the agreement shall be valid for a term of 5 years (now, 20 years). Creates additional notice requirements in the form of written notice by registered mail, return receipt requested, to all owners of property affected by the agreement and all owners of adjoining property, and, in the case of agreements entered into on or after January 1, 2007, requires a public hearing. Also eliminates the provision that notice is required only in the case of agreements entered into on or after January 1, 2006. Effective immediately.
